diff --git a/pom.xml b/pom.xml index c3f797d..0510a9e 100644 --- a/pom.xml +++ b/pom.xml @@ -206,7 +206,7 @@ com.zdjizhi galaxy - 1.0.6 + 1.0.8 slf4j-log4j12 diff --git a/src/main/java/com/zdjizhi/utils/IpUtils.java b/src/main/java/com/zdjizhi/utils/IpUtils.java index 4f7e5d7..43bfc11 100644 --- a/src/main/java/com/zdjizhi/utils/IpUtils.java +++ b/src/main/java/com/zdjizhi/utils/IpUtils.java @@ -7,20 +7,20 @@ public class IpUtils { /** * IP定位库工具类 */ - public static IpLookup ipLookup = new IpLookup.Builder(false) - .loadDataFileV4(CommonConfig.IP_MMDB_PATH + "ip_v4.mmdb") - .loadDataFileV6(CommonConfig.IP_MMDB_PATH + "ip_v6.mmdb") - .loadDataFilePrivateV4(CommonConfig.IP_MMDB_PATH + "ip_private_v4.mmdb") - .loadDataFilePrivateV6(CommonConfig.IP_MMDB_PATH + "ip_private_v6.mmdb") + public static IpLookupV2 ipLookup = new IpLookupV2.Builder(false) + .loadDataFileV4(CommonConfig.IP_MMDB_PATH + "ip_v4_built_in.mmdb") + .loadDataFileV6(CommonConfig.IP_MMDB_PATH + "ip_v6_built_in.mmdb") + .loadDataFilePrivateV4(CommonConfig.IP_MMDB_PATH + "ip_v4_user_defined.mmdb") + .loadDataFilePrivateV6(CommonConfig.IP_MMDB_PATH + "ip_v6_user_defined.mmdb") .build(); public static void main(String[] args) { System.out.println(ipLookup.countryLookup("49.7.115.37")); -// String ips = "192.168.50.23,192.168.50.45,192.168.56.9,192.168.56.8,192.168.50.58,192.168.56.7,192.168.56.6,192.168.50.40,192.168.50.19,192.168.50.6,192.168.50.4,192.168.56.17,192.168.50.27,192.168.50.26,192.168.50.18,192.168.56.3,192.168.56.10"; -// for (String ip:ips.split(",")){ -// System.out.println(ip+"--"+ipLookup.countryLookup(ip)); -// } + String ips = "182.168.50.23,182.168.50.45,182.168.56.9,182.168.56.8,92.168.50.58,19.168.56.7,12.168.56.6,2.168.50.40,1.168.50.19,9.168.50.6,2.168.50.4,192.168.56.17,192.168.50.27,192.168.50.26,192.168.50.18,192.168.56.3,192.168.56.10"; + for (String ip:ips.split(",")){ + System.out.println(ip+"--"+ipLookup.countryLookup(ip)); + } }